Parent Governor Recruitment Documentation
Please find below, application paperwork for the role of Parent Governor at Benjamin Britten School.
Please note, you may apply to become a Parent Governor if you have a child in any year group at the school. Although the term of office is for four years, your child does not have to be at the school for a further four years in order for you to sustain the position, they just need to be at the school at the time of you applying to become a Governor.
Why become a Governor?
School governance allows you to develop your skills, both personally and professionally, including:
- Strategic planning
- Experience on a board
- Holding senior leaders to account
- Finance, and maintaining oversight of large budgets
- Human resources and performance management
- Project management
- Communication and teamwork
- Decision making
As a parent governor, your role is:
- To bring a parental perspective to the issues discussed – you're not there to speak 'on behalf' of the parent body. This means you're using your experience as a parent to help inform the board’s thinking.
- No different from other governors
Local Governing Body meetings take place three times a year. Inbetween these meetings, there will be opportunities for you to support the school in further business such as school improvement plans, recruitment of staff and recognition of pupil achievement. You will be asked to undertake safeguarding training, and will be given opportunities to undertake further training if desired.
